系統版本
sudo chmod 777 給了相關權限 還是沒法運行
sudo chmod 777 ida64.app
sudo xattr -rd com.apple.quarantine ida64.app 即可運行
鏈接地址🔗 : 鏈接: https://pan.baidu.com/s/1v3RcCCMlRCT9a01AWk-exA 提取碼: r32v
####
但是我一直報錯
這是由於多輸入法問題造成的,最簡單的解決方案就是在使用IDA的時候切換到默認輸入英文狀態,不要使用第三方輸入法軟件,比如搜狗輸入法等等,就解決啟動的問題!
最佳的解決方案,參考這個項目:https://github.com/fjh658/IDA7.0_SP
IDA7.0_SP
Fixed when multiply input method the IDA pro7.0 on mojave, ida will crash in non-english input method.
Fixed shortcuts do not work in non-english input method. Eg: F2, tab, ctrl+enter etc.
Added load bundle for open dialog (The official Qt does not support this feature, but this is suitable for ida )
還修復了快捷鍵等問題
將下面的文件下載下來替換掉就可以了
的確是厲害,我cd到這個目錄,把解壓之后的這個文件替換掉,就可以了,enjoy!!
上面是我自己網絡上找的教程,
下面是一個找到的完整的教程,復制過來,以供參考,
我的目前是11.6的mac已經成功安裝了,所以不存在不能安裝的問題,2021年10月23號,mac11.6安裝成功
MacOS 10.15安裝IDA7
MacOS 10.15對系統做了比較大的改動,之前的IDA7.0
無法在10.15上安裝,而在10.14安裝是正常的,解決方案是通過MacOS 10.14
安裝,然后把安裝好的文件放到10.15系統運行
Mac 10.14安裝IDA
-
下載並安裝虛擬機
VMware Fusion
-
下載並安裝
MacOS 10.14
鏡像鏈接: https://pan.baidu.com/s/1XVPCyecg4xIbxnvR6_ukDA 提取碼: y8xn
-
下載
IDA7.0
,安裝到MacOS10.14上
安裝完得到

復制到Mac 10.15
拷貝10.14系統下的到/Applications/IDA Pro 7.0
目錄到10.15系統的/Applications/
下
-
直接打開會直接崩潰
需要替換一下
libqcocoa.dylib
文件,在這里可以找到1
/Applications/IDA Pro 7.0/ida.app/Contents/PlugIns/platforms/libqcocoa.dylib
-
每次打開會報授權過期
解壓Fixes/IDA Mac 7 pacth.7z
並替換下面文件1
2
3
4/Applications/IDA Pro 7.0/ida.app/Contents/MacOS/ida
/Applications/IDA Pro 7.0/ida.app/Contents/MacOS/ida64
/Applications/IDA Pro 7.0/ida.app/Contents/MacOS/libida.dylib
/Applications/IDA Pro 7.0/ida.app/Contents/MacOS/libida64.dylib -
打開
ida64
如果出現無法打開的情況可能是權限問題
1
2
3
4# 如果沒有執行權限,需要先添加,之后就能直接啟動了
cd /Applications/IDA Pro 7.0/ida.app/Contents/MacOS
chmod +x ida
chmod +x ida64
下面是我處理后的文件,可以直接拿到Mac10.15
使用
######